Product Description:
Skincare routine with DERMA KR Ascorbyl Glucoside Solution 12% Face Serum, a potent elixir designed to transform your complexion. Formulated with a high concentration of ascorbyl glucoside, a stable derivative of vitamin C, this serum is your ticket to achieving brighter, firmer, and more radiant skin. Harnessing the power of ascorbyl glucoside, it delivers powerful antioxidant benefits to combat free radicals and protect the skin from environmental damage. Ascorbyl glucoside also converts to pure vitamin C (ascorbic acid) upon application, effectively brightening the skin, fading dark spots, and enhancing overall radiance. In addition to its brightening effects, it promotes collagen synthesis, helping to improve skin firmness and elasticity while reducing the appearance of fine lines and wrinkles. By inhibiting melanin production, vitamin C also works to even out skin tone and reduce the appearance of hyperpigmentation, revealing a more uniform complexion.

Ascorbyl Glucoside
Common Name(s): Aa2g,2-o-alpha-d-glucopyranosyl-l-ascorbic acid
CAS Number: 129499-78-1
DESCRIPTION
What It Does: Provides stable gradual-release vitamin c activity for brightening and antioxidant protection.
Why It's Used: Most formulation-stable vitamin c derivative โ ascorbyl glucoside remains stable in aqueous formulations where pure ascorbic acid oxidises within days, providing sustained vitamin c delivery over weeks of shelf life.
How It Works: Alpha-glucoside bond resists oxidation until cleaved by skin alpha-glucosidase enzymes. releases free l-ascorbic acid in viable epidermis. released ascorbic acid inhibits tyrosinase, stimulates collagen synthesis, and provides antioxidant activity. glucose group provides enhanced water solubility vs ascorbic acid.

SCIENTIFIC NOTE
Ascorbyl glucoside's stability advantage (18+ months in aqueous formulation vs days for ascorbic acid) arises from the glucose group's steric protection of ascorbic acid's c2 enediol that is the primary oxidation site. glucosidase cleavage in skin removes this protection in situ, releasing active ascorbic acid only where enzymatic activity exists โ providing both formulation stability and bioactivation where needed.

Sodium Hyaluronate
Common Name(s): Sodium salt of hyaluronic acid,naha
CAS Number: 9067-32-7
DESCRIPTION
What It Does: Provides hyaluronic acid hydration in the most formulation-stable and compatible form.
Why It's Used: The standard form of ha used in cosmetics โ more stable than free ha, better solubility, and equivalent skin hydration benefits.
How It Works: Sodium salt reduces the polyelectrolyte repulsion of ha chains, allowing better packing in formulations. on skin, sodium ions dissociate and the ha chain unfolds to its full water-binding conformation. provides full ha humectant and barrier benefits equivalent to free ha.

SCIENTIFIC NOTE
The sodium salt form of ha has approximately 10% better water solubility than free hyaluronic acid at equivalent molecular weight due to reduced chain-chain electrostatic repulsion from partial sodium counterion screening. this improved solubility enables higher concentration formulations without viscosity issues.
